Isabel Veloso counteracts criticism of wanting more children: “Unhappy people”

The influencer Isabel Veloso 18, which is undergoing treatment against Hodgkin’s lymphoma. he countered the criticism he received about having the desire for more children, after the birth of Arthur 3 months, the result of the relationship with the boyfriend, Lucas Borbas 26.

Isabel expressed the desire to have one or two children, but explained that she is prioritizing the little Arthur.

“I want to see my firstborn grow up and if by any chance I was superb of my treatment, if I could spend a while without treatment, no risk, I would have a second child. But, I think at the moment, it is very impossible, you know?” He said in an interview with CNN .

Isabel also said that at the beginning of her life as an influencer, it was very difficult to deal with criticism. She said that every time she read the comments calling her a liar, without even seeking to understand her story, she was very bad.

“I think, sincerely, that each person should live their lives. The internet is a very rotten place. It has their good sides, has their beautiful side, but the people who are there have not yet learned to touch their life and are very unhappy,” he continued.

Isabel believes that netizens discount their frustrations in other people, and that all criticisms are just feelings that are in their hearts. “There is no other rational explanation for such cruelty.”

“Knowing that I was living the worst moment of my life and many people still doubting precisely because of an appearance. It’s very complicated […] Nowadays I read much better with all this, I don’t care, because I know my truth and I finally understood that I don’t need to prove anything to anyone because I’m not lying and I live my truth, ”he said.

The only comments I can’t stand and I think I will never bear, precisely because I am a mother, they are about my pregnancy and about my son. I will never allow people to attack my son, ”concluded Isabel.
